Project

General

Profile

Feature #33411

Umbrella #25917: Move business logic from Django to middlewared and make websocket API feature complete

Convert Storage:Replication to Middlewared

Added by William Grzybowski about 1 year ago. Updated 12 months ago.

Status:
Done
Priority:
Expected
Assignee:
Waqar Ahmed
Category:
Middleware
Target version:
Estimated time:
Severity:
Medium
Reason for Closing:
Reason for Blocked:
Needs QA:
No
Needs Doc:
No
Needs Merging:
No
Needs Automation:
Yes
Support Suite Ticket:
n/a
Hardware Configuration:

Description

Ticket to track transfer of business logic from Django/GUI to middlewared and making use of middleware client in GUI.


Related issues

Related to FreeNAS - Bug #35587: Fix instances where pool.snapshot was renamed to pool.snapshottask in middlewareDone
Related to FreeNAS - Bug #36008: Fix for resolved hostnames validatorDone

Associated revisions

Revision 99c7045a (diff)
Added by Waqar Ahmed about 1 year ago

Storage: Replication moved to Middlewared
Ticket: #33411

Revision 60f0dc46 (diff)
Added by Waqar Ahmed about 1 year ago

Storage: Replication moved to Middlewared
Ticket: #33411

Revision 8f2e21fc (diff)
Added by Waqar Ahmed about 1 year ago

Storage: Replication moved to Middlewared
Ticket: #33411

Revision cd4a6a97 (diff)
Added by Waqar Ahmed about 1 year ago

Storage: Replication moved to Middlewared
Ticket: #33411

Revision 871c6a81 (diff)
Added by Waqar Ahmed about 1 year ago

Storage: Replication moved to Middlewared (#1206)

  • Storage: Replication moved to Middlewared
    Ticket: #33411

History

#1 Updated by Waqar Ahmed about 1 year ago

  • Status changed from Unscreened to In Progress

#2 Updated by Waqar Ahmed about 1 year ago

  • Status changed from In Progress to Ready for Testing

#3 Updated by Dru Lavigne about 1 year ago

  • Target version changed from 11.2-RC2 to 11.2-BETA1

#4 Updated by Bonnie Follweiler about 1 year ago

I assigned this ticket to Ethan

#5 Updated by Bonnie Follweiler about 1 year ago

This ticket can't be tested until https://redmine.ixsystems.com/issues/35587 is fixed

#6 Updated by Bonnie Follweiler about 1 year ago

  • Related to Bug #35587: Fix instances where pool.snapshot was renamed to pool.snapshottask in middleware added

#7 Updated by Bonnie Follweiler 12 months ago

  • Related to Bug #36008: Fix for resolved hostnames validator added

#8 Updated by Bonnie Follweiler 12 months ago

We also need https://redmine.ixsystems.com/issues/36008 to have passed testing to test this ticket

#9 Updated by Eric Turgeon 12 months ago

The replication was successfully created on FreeNAS-11.2-INTERNAL12, everything seems to work fine. I was able to have snapshot replication was sent to the other freenas in both cases.

#10 Updated by Eric Turgeon 12 months ago

  • Status changed from Ready for Testing to Passed Testing
  • Needs QA changed from Yes to No

#11 Updated by Dru Lavigne 12 months ago

  • Status changed from Passed Testing to Done

Also available in: Atom PDF